Runbook: ReceiptWren donation mailer, retry procedure. If the nightly batch stalls, first confirm the Ledgerfield export completed; the mailer refuses to start without a sealed export manifest. Do not re-run the batch blindly — duplicate receipts are a compliance problem and require manual voiding. Instead, drain the stuck queue, verify the dedupe table has yesterday's checksums, then restart the worker pool one node at a time. Record the trace token from the stalled run below for the audit trail.

session token of kageg-kajep = htk31_8e387f741d208554faee18934428597

## Deployment

Squeegee-SQL lint rules are packaged per environment and deployed alongside your plugin bundle. Plugin authors should not hardcode rule severities; the host resolves them at load time from the deployed ruleset. Publish your plugin with the manifest schema version pinned, then trigger a deploy through the registry. The host applies the configuration shown below at startup.

config for bagef-hawep:
oliath:
  log_level: error
  metrics_host: metrics.oliath.tolvaqsys.internal
  pool_size: 32

Finance Review Summary — Q2 Budget Request, Orlaine Division

The Orlaine division has requested 310k in incremental funding for tooling upgrades and two analyst hires. The review committee examined the supporting forecasts and found the payback assumptions reasonable, though the hiring timeline is optimistic. Contingency was trimmed from 12% to 8%. The finance team recommends conditional approval, with a mid-quarter checkpoint. The request should be read alongside the strategic context noted below.

confidential, tagag-kahof: Rusathox Partners plans to lower the Gorox list price by 63 percent in December.

Driver Assignment Heuristic (Dispatchly Core)

The assignment endpoint ranks available drivers by proximity, acceptance rate, and shift remaining. Ties break on lowest active-job count. Overrides via the priority flag skip scoring entirely — use only for escalations. If a request returns no candidates, the zone is saturated; do not retry for 60 seconds. All calls to the heuristic service must authenticate with the internal service key shown below.

gateway credential: kto3_qfe